New Library Update: October 1, 2007
Construction continues apace in the new East Campus Library. The project remains on schedule with a substantial completion date of March 20, 2008. The next few weeks of construction should see the following:
- Finishing the steel roof on the curved section
- Continued work on the east elevation paneled wall
- Continued glass installation throughout the project
- Elevator installation
- Drywall on all floors
- Painting in selected areas
- Tile work in bathrooms
- Chiller installation in IT machine room

Work also continues on planning for the new library:
- Recruitment for the first of two new librarian positions for the new library will begin this week
- A Libraries & Educational Technologies steering group has been formed to coordinate planning for new library programs and services
- Collections issues are currently being addressed. Current issues of note are:
- Deciding the nature and scope of a new "browsing" (recreational reading) collection for the new library
- Completing weeding of the book collections
- Identifying materials in Carrier Library's reference collection that are candidates for duplication
